A simple wget style program using Haskell and http-enumerator

{-# LANGUAGE OverloadedStrings #-} | |
import Control.Monad.IO.Class (liftIO) | |
import Network (withSocketsDo) | |
import System.Environment (getArgs, getProgName) | |
import qualified Data.ByteString.Char8 as BS | |
import qualified Data.ByteString.Lazy.Char8 as LBS | |
import qualified Data.CaseInsensitive as CI | |
import qualified Network.HTTP.Enumerator as HE | |
import qualified Network.HTTP.Types as HT | |
main :: IO () | |
main | |
= do args <- getArgs | |
name <- getProgName | |
case args of | |
[url] -> withSocketsDo $ grabUrl url | |
_ -> error $ "Usage: " ++ name ++ " <url>" | |
grabUrl :: String -> IO () | |
grabUrl url | |
= do let request = mkRequest url | |
HE.Response sc rh bs <- liftIO $ HE.withManager $ HE.httpLbsRedirect request | |
if sc /= 200 | |
then error $ "Http error : " ++ show sc | |
else writeResponse sc rh bs | |
mkRequest :: String -> HE.Request m | |
mkRequest url | |
= case HE.parseUrl url of | |
Nothing -> error $ "Failed to parse target url '" ++ url ++ "'." | |
Just r -> r { HE.rawBody = True } | |
writeResponse :: Int -> HT.ResponseHeaders -> LBS.ByteString -> IO () | |
writeResponse sc rh bs | |
= do let fname = "he-get.output" | |
LBS.writeFile fname | |
$ LBS.unlines | |
$ LBS.concat [ "HTTP/1.0 ", LBS.pack (show sc) ] | |
: LBS.fromChunks (map (\ (f, v) -> BS.concat [ CI.original f, ": ", v, "\n" ]) rh) | |
: LBS.pack "" | |
: [ bs ] | |
putStrLn $ "Output written to '" ++ fname ++ "'." |
